A Detailed Look at the Case

A 25-year-old woman with severe obesity presented with a 1-week history of blurred vision and headaches. Upon a thorough neurological examination, it was discovered that she had optic-disk swelling in both eyes. This condition, known as papilledema, is often associated with increased intracranial pressure.

Further medical investigation was pursued to understand the cause of these symptoms. An MRI of the patient's brain revealed two key findings: flattened posterior globes and an empty sella. The posterior globe refers to the back part of the eye, which can become flattened due to increased pressure within the skull. The empty sella is a condition where the pituitary gland, located at the base of the brain, is shrunken or flattened, often due to increased intracranial pressure.

Linking Obesity with Neurological Symptoms

While these findings may initially seem unrelated to her obesity, research suggests there could be a link. Severe obesity can contribute to a variety of health complications, including increased intracranial pressure. This pressure can lead to the observed optic-disk swelling, flattened posterior globes, and empty sella.

Interestingly, the woman’s MRI findings also revealed stenoses of the transverse sinuses. These are two veins that drain blood from the brain, and their narrowing (stenosis) can increase intracranial pressure. A lumbar puncture, a procedure that measures the pressure in the brain and spinal cord, would likely reveal elevated opening pressure in this case.
